- who: Biogeosciences and collaborators from the University of Maine, Aubert Hall, Orono, ME, USA have published the paper: Inferring phytoplankton carbon and eco-physiological rates from diel cycles of spectral particulate beam-attenuation coefficient, in the Journal: (JOURNAL)
- what: The aim of this study was thus to develop a methodology to quantitatively interpret the diel variations in spectral cp.
